Design decisions for software should take the interface into consideration. That said, I do think ring menu systems can work on PC and mobile. Some mobile apps have a context menu triggered by a long press, I could see a ring-type menu working there. As for PC, I'm not aware of that many examples, but the pop up palette in Krita is one example that could be easily adapted to be closer to a SoM/SoE-style ring menu.